Netball - 26. September 2007.

Plummer turns up the heat for final selection camp





With a squad of 22 players vying for just 12 spots, Plummer is looking for a versatile and a holistic unit that can adapt to the demands of a World Championship campaign.

“We are split over a couple of decisions, but we are looking for variety within the team to ensure all bases are covered if we do have an injury during the competition,” Plummer said.

“We will try a couple of our shooters in wing attack in case they are required there, and the same at the defence end in the circle and on the wing. “

The 17-strong Australian squad will be joined by invitees Madison Browne, Renae Hallinan,
Kimberley Purcell, Kate Beveridge and Laura Geitz at the four day selection camp this evening at the Australian Institute of Sport (AIS).

And with only 45 days remaining and the pressure building ahead of the New World Netball World
Championships in Auckland, the message from the coach heading into camp is clear.
“We want every player to give it their best shot, this is the World Championships so nothing but the best will do,” Plummer said.

The New World Netball World Championships from November 10-17 features 16 nations in action at Auckland`s Trusts Stadium.

Australia is currently ranked number two in the world behind the New Zealand Silver Ferns.
